Ticket: Staging env misconfigured for Siftgate bloom filter

The bloom layer in front of the Pellet KV store is rejecting all lookups in staging because the env file was copied from the dev template without credentials. False-positive tuning values are fine; only the auth line is missing. To unblock the weekly demo, the Pellet admission secret must be set on the following line.

env line for yaguf-fajop: LEDGER_TOKEN13=fb08984397349

☐ Lost-badge walk-through (Day 1, reception). When a new starter at Ferndale Atrium reports a lost badge, don't panic them — it happens weekly. Log it in the Gatebook, deactivate the old badge via the Kestrel panel, and issue a paper visitor sticker for the rest of the day. Remind them replacement badges come from Security on Level 3, usually within two hours. So they're not stranded at the turnstiles in the meantime, give them the temporary door code below.

door code, bafog-bawif: bdg-LBEEAI-75528164

Handover note — Crumbwheel order cutoffs.

Welcome aboard. The bakery cutoff rule in Crumbwheel closes same-day orders at 14:00 local to each storefront, not UTC — this has bitten us twice. Holiday overrides live in the calendar service and take precedence silently, so always check there first when a cutoff looks wrong. To unlock the calendar service's admin console after a restart, enter the recovery passphrase below.

vault phrase of bagap-bahaf = silion-pelox-sorox-casdor-quenwyn-fraax-eliox-praael-kelion-quenvan-kasox-rusael-norius-belvan